Vodafone to range the Sony Xperia XZ3

During IFA we took a look at the Sony Xperia XZ3. It has a 6″ 2880 x 1440 OLED screen, a 19 megapixel Exmor RS MotionEye camera at the back, a 13 megapixel up-front and an S-Force speaker. Powered by a 3,330mAh battery, it has a Qualcomm Snapdragon 845 CPU, 4GB RAM, 64GB storage, NFC, dual-band WiFi, DLNA and a fingerprint scanner. You also get...
